Step-by-step explanation:
This is a question on some unit conversions.
First we convert 3 pounds to ounces.
Given 16 ounces = 1 pound,
3 pounds = 3 x 16 ounces = 48 ounces
Next, we will find the number of cherries required.
Number of Cherries required = Total weight of cherries needed (in ounces) / Weight per cherry.
= [tex]\frac{48}{0.5}[/tex]
= 48 * 2
= 96 cherries
